Output 44c109d68624180a6208551e9863198c68ce152fbbe83ae5faba06bf4d42e7c7:14

value
103122454
script pubkey
OP_0 OP_PUSHBYTES_20 d60bbb807d14af961af746c39fc151b104778b63
address
bc1q6c9mhqrazjhevxhhgmpels23kyz80zmr5x65t2
transaction
44c109d68624180a6208551e9863198c68ce152fbbe83ae5faba06bf4d42e7c7
confirmations
167521
spent
true